If you have down-time from tanning (and it's ok with the boss...unless YOU ARE the boss), it's the perfect time to practice.
Here's how to start ...visit your local grocery store, buy Jasmine Rice (this works the best). Go to craft store and buy a few .005 pens (these work the best). Total cost is under $5.00. Start with short names.... I bought another bead tray and started separating the good pieces of rice by most Popular Names. Trays are marked accordingly: Kathy, Kathie, Katie, Kim are all in one little tray. It's tons of funs!!! [ This Message was edited by: K-tina on 2002-06-28 18:29 ] |
